A square has an area of 9yd^2. What is the length of each side?
BlackZzzverrR [31]

Answer: The side length is 3 yards.

Step-by-step explanation:

To find the area of a square, you have to square one of it's side lengths since they all share the same length.  Since we know the area, and we need to find the side length so we just need to find the square root of the area.

\sqrt{9} = 3    

The side length is 3 yards.
